Our DASH- Dog Show is BACK for the second year running. Big and BETTER, In partnership with DOG'S TRUST.

About this event
At our Pet-Friendly CAFE we’re obsessed with our four-legged friends so much, we're dedicating one whole day to them this July.

We would like to invite ALL DOGS and their owners to DASH- Blackhorse Ave. to participate in our 2nd ANNUAL DOG SHOW. Tail wagging guaranteed and fun for all the family. Open to dogs of all breeds, shapes and sizes.

In association with MINI Ireland, Paw Pool and Oscar’s Farm there will be some INCREDIBLE prizes on the day.

The entry fee of €15 per category automatically enters all holders into an hourly draw for prizes from DASH-, Oscar's Farm and PawPool. Proceeds of all the entry fees will be donated to Dog's Trust.

Culture Date with Dublin 8

Various Locations

Culture Date with Dublin 8 is a neighbourhood initiative, which aims to celebrate Dublin 8’s rich cultural, historical and architectural heritage while encouraging people who are living, working and visiting the area to explore what is on their doorstep. This collaborative project and programme of events aims to connect with and amplify the wider efforts being made to regenerate the area, highlighting all the great things there are to see and do in Dublin 8 to locals and visitors alike. This years event takes place from Wednesday 8th to Sunday 12th May.
